Rule for adult places ?

Hello, I was wondering if there is a specific set of rules for "adult places". Let me explain what I mean by that...

 

The other day I walked in front of some kind of strip club in Paris (The Guy's Club, St Germain Paris) and I thought, hey I could add this place to the map : but it was already listed (so I ended up adding a photo of the front store...). But I guess that you don"t upload photos of inside those kind of places to the map right ? (I am not going inside anyway... but I was just wondering...)

 

Anyone has any feedback about that very hot subject ?

 

Thanks in advance.

About adult places, I guess we have to refer to this text 

 

"We do not allow pornographic, sexually explicit, or strongly suggestive content.  Content with non-sexual nudity may be permitted, where relevant to the location being captured, and where permissible under local law. "

 

But then I guess that everyone can read the rule and/ but ....may interpret it differently.

 

I am in France, so I am  not surprised if I see a flyer on a shop with a "suggestive content"...aimed for advertising a business...

Hi @GéraldM (and all), 

 

Among the same rules, if you click on "privacy" on the right, there is also this one: "Be a good neighbor and don't publish content in which people are identifiable without their permission. This is particularly important in sensitive locations, where people may object to publishing their image". So this would also apply to the "guests" or "customers" in that place. One might be interested to spend an evening in such a "relaxed" place but may not like the idea that his wife (or her husband) will see those pictures later. Or the colleagues or bosses... 

 

With such sensitive places, you could organize a photo session with the owner (if he's interested); show the interior when there are no customers (and of course, "artists").

 

Certainly a butcher's shop is different. Not so sensitive.
